Highlights of Cisco 128GB DDR4 RAM
Cisco UCS-MR-128G8RS-H is a high-capacity 128GB DDR4 registered memory module engineered for enterprise servers and storage platforms. This server-grade DIMM combines dependable error correction, low-voltage efficiency, and octal-rank density to support virtualization, databases, and heavy workloads.
Manufacturer Details
- Manufacturer: Cisco
- Model Number: UCS-MR-128G8RS-H
- Product Type: 128GB DDR4 SDRAM memory module
Technical Highlights
Memory Capacity and Format
- Capacity: 128 GB
- Form Factor: 288-pin DIMM
- Module Type: Registered (buffered) DIMM
Performance and Electrical Details
- Speed: 2666 MHz (PC4-21300)
- Latency: CL19
- Voltage: 1.2V low-voltage operation
- Data Protection: ECC (Error-Correcting Code)
- Rank: Octal Rank (8Rx4)
Compatibility and Supported Platforms
Blade Server Compatibility
- Blade Models: Cisco UCS B200 M5; Cisco UCS B480 M5
Rack and Storage Server Compatibility
- Rack Servers: Cisco UCS C220 M5; C240 M5; C480 M5; C4200 Series
- Storage Servers: Cisco UCS S3260

Registered Memory Architecture for Stability
The Cisco UCS-MR-128G8RS-H memory module is built with registered (buffered) architecture, which enhances stability and reliability in server environments. Registered memory includes a register between the DRAM modules and the system's memory controller, reducing electrical load and improving signal quality.
Reliable Performance in Enterprise Systems
Registered memory is designed to support large memory configurations without compromising performance. By buffering control signals, this module ensures stable operation even when multiple memory modules are installed within a system. This makes it ideal for enterprise servers that require extensive memory capacity.
